Transaction d07bafa6ebabf034294551056bb02435ca05885f3f81c97091440c5331ad9e64

3 Input
2 Outputs
  • d07bafa6ebabf034294551056bb02435ca05885f3f81c97091440c5331ad9e64:0
  • value  2689590
    address  38sqfYcyHAJy1fNyipKr84qHKXA92CSnZX
  • d07bafa6ebabf034294551056bb02435ca05885f3f81c97091440c5331ad9e64:1
  • value  1000080
    address  3PCaej6WGgkjHbtEhd54ea1cDA2r45cCbP